Mosquito Life Span & Life Cycle Eggs Mosquitoes lay up to several hundred eggs at a time. Mosquito eggs can only hatch when they are exposed to water. It is the reason these insects lay their eggs in or near water. Mosquito species prefer different water habitats to lay their eggs. It may range from flood water to standing water collected in containers like a flowerpot or a tire near your home.
